The Legal Landscape of Online Casinos in the USA
While federal law prohibits interstate online gambling, many states have embraced online casinos to boost revenue and tourism. States like New Jersey, Pennsylvania, and Michigan lead the way, offering regulated platforms that ensure fair play and consumer protection. Players should verify their state’s laws before engaging with online casinos to avoid legal risks. Always prioritize licensed operators to enjoy a secure gaming environment.
- Check state-specific regulations for online gambling legality.
- Verify casino licenses from reputable authorities like the New Jersey Division of Gaming Enforcement.

Security and Responsible Gambling Practices
Security and responsible gambling are non-negotiable aspects of online casino play. Reputable sites employ advanced encryption to protect personal and financial data, while responsible gambling tools help players manage their habits. Features like session timers, loss limits, and self-exclusion options empower users to maintain control. Always gamble within your means and seek support if needed through organizations like Gamblers Anonymous.
- Enable two-factor authentication for added account security.
- Set daily or weekly spending limits to avoid overspending.
